A 45-year-old Cleveland man died Tuesday after being brought to University Hospitals Cleveland Medical Center from an unknown location, and his death is now under review as a suspected homicide, according to the Cuyahoga County Medical Examiner.

The decedent has been identified as Cleveland resident Nicholas Quarterman. He was taken to the hospital on Tuesday and died later that same day. Investigators are still working to piece together how and from where he was brought in, and what exactly led to his death. Cleveland police have not released additional details as the case moves forward.

According to 19 News, the medical examiner has listed Quarterman’s death as a suspected homicide and formally identified him in their records. The station reports that University Hospitals Cleveland Medical Center notified the examiner’s office about the case on Thursday and that it has reached out to the Cleveland Division of Police for comment.

What 'suspected homicide' means

When medical examiners use the term “homicide” as a manner of death, they are signaling that another person’s actions are believed to have caused the death. It is a clinical, medical determination, not a courtroom verdict about criminal intent.

According to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ention, manner-of-death classifications such as natural, accident, suicide, homicide and undetermined are designed to guide investigations and public health data. On their own, they do not decide whether someone will be charged with a crime or what those charges might be.

How the probe moves forward

Per the Cuyahoga County Medical Examiner’s Office, the office is responsible for conducting autopsies, ordering toxicology tests and working with law enforcement before formally certifying a cause and manner of death. Those steps typically shape how detectives and prosecutors evaluate a case behind the scenes.
